Class XmlTransformStatistics


public final class XmlTransformStatistics extends StatisticsDataSection
  • Field Details

    • MLRDS_LENGTH

      public static final int MLRDS_LENGTH
      Constant: 0x0274 = 628
      See Also:
    • MLRIDR

      public static final int MLRIDR
      Constant: 0x71 = 113
      See Also:
    • MLR_VERS

      public static final int MLR_VERS
      Constant: 0x01 = 1
      See Also:
    • MLR_VALIDATION_NO

      public static final int MLR_VALIDATION_NO
      Constant: 0x01 = 1
      See Also:
    • MLR_VALIDATION_YES

      public static final int MLR_VALIDATION_YES
      Constant: 0x02 = 2
      See Also:
    • MLR_CSDAPI_CHANGE

      public static final int MLR_CSDAPI_CHANGE
      Constant: 0x01 = 1
      See Also:
    • MLR_CSDBATCH_CHANGE

      public static final int MLR_CSDBATCH_CHANGE
      Constant: 0x02 = 2
      See Also:
    • MLR_DREPAPI_CHANGE

      public static final int MLR_DREPAPI_CHANGE
      Constant: 0x03 = 3
      See Also:
    • MLR_CREATE_CHANGE

      public static final int MLR_CREATE_CHANGE
      Constant: 0x04 = 4
      See Also:
    • MLR_DYNAMIC_CHANGE

      public static final int MLR_DYNAMIC_CHANGE
      Constant: 0x08 = 8
      See Also:
    • MLR_DYNAMIC_INSTALL

      public static final int MLR_DYNAMIC_INSTALL
      Constant: 0x08 = 8
      See Also:
    • MLR_BUNDLE_INSTALL

      public static final int MLR_BUNDLE_INSTALL
      Constant: 0x09 = 9
      See Also:
  • Method Details

    • mlrdsLen

      public int mlrdsLen()
      MLRDS_LEN value.
      Returns:
      int MLRDS_LEN value
    • mlrdsId

      public int mlrdsId()
      MLRDS_ID value.
      Returns:
      int MLRDS_ID value
    • mlrdsVers

      public int mlrdsVers()
      MLRDS_VERS value.
      Returns:
      int MLRDS_VERS value
    • mlrXmltransformName

      public String mlrXmltransformName()
      MLR_XMLTRANSFORM_NAME value.
      Returns:
      String MLR_XMLTRANSFORM_NAME value
    • mlrMsgValidation

      public int mlrMsgValidation()
      MLR_MSG_VALIDATION value.
      Returns:
      int MLR_MSG_VALIDATION value
    • mlrXsdbindFile

      public String mlrXsdbindFile()
      MLR_XSDBIND_FILE value.
      Returns:
      String MLR_XSDBIND_FILE value
    • mlrXmlschemaFile

      public String mlrXmlschemaFile()
      MLR_XMLSCHEMA_FILE value.
      Returns:
      String MLR_XMLSCHEMA_FILE value
    • mlrXmltrnfmUseCount

      public long mlrXmltrnfmUseCount()
      MLR_XMLTRNFM_USE_COUNT value.
      Returns:
      long MLR_XMLTRNFM_USE_COUNT value
    • mlrXmltrnfmDefineSource

      public String mlrXmltrnfmDefineSource()
      MLR_XMLTRNFM_DEFINE_SOURCE value.
      Returns:
      String MLR_XMLTRNFM_DEFINE_SOURCE value
    • mlrXmltrnfmChangeTime

      public LocalDateTime mlrXmltrnfmChangeTime()
      MLR_XMLTRNFM_CHANGE_TIME STCK value converted to LocalDateTime (nanosecond precision).

      Use mlrXmltrnfmChangeTimeRawValue() for a BigInteger containing the complete STCK value.

      Returns:
      LocalDateTime MLR_XMLTRNFM_CHANGE_TIME STCK converted to LocalDateTime
      See Also:
    • mlrXmltrnfmChangeTimeRawValue

      public BigInteger mlrXmltrnfmChangeTimeRawValue()
      MLR_XMLTRNFM_CHANGE_TIME STCK value.
      Returns:
      BigInteger MLR_XMLTRNFM_CHANGE_TIME STCK value
    • mlrXmltrnfmChangeUserid

      public String mlrXmltrnfmChangeUserid()
      MLR_XMLTRNFM_CHANGE_USERID value.
      Returns:
      String MLR_XMLTRNFM_CHANGE_USERID value
    • mlrXmltrnfmChangeAgent

      public int mlrXmltrnfmChangeAgent()
      MLR_XMLTRNFM_CHANGE_AGENT value.
      Returns:
      int MLR_XMLTRNFM_CHANGE_AGENT value
    • mlrXmltrnfmInstallAgent

      public int mlrXmltrnfmInstallAgent()
      MLR_XMLTRNFM_INSTALL_AGENT value.
      Returns:
      int MLR_XMLTRNFM_INSTALL_AGENT value
    • mlrXmltrnfmInstallTime

      public LocalDateTime mlrXmltrnfmInstallTime()
      MLR_XMLTRNFM_INSTALL_TIME STCK value converted to LocalDateTime (nanosecond precision).

      Use mlrXmltrnfmInstallTimeRawValue() for a BigInteger containing the complete STCK value.

      Returns:
      LocalDateTime MLR_XMLTRNFM_INSTALL_TIME STCK converted to LocalDateTime
      See Also:
    • mlrXmltrnfmInstallTimeRawValue

      public BigInteger mlrXmltrnfmInstallTimeRawValue()
      MLR_XMLTRNFM_INSTALL_TIME STCK value.
      Returns:
      BigInteger MLR_XMLTRNFM_INSTALL_TIME STCK value
    • mlrXmltrnfmInstallUserid

      public String mlrXmltrnfmInstallUserid()
      MLR_XMLTRNFM_INSTALL_USERID value.
      Returns:
      String MLR_XMLTRNFM_INSTALL_USERID value
    • mlrValidationNo

      public boolean mlrValidationNo()
      Return true if mlrMsgValidation() equals MLR_VALIDATION_NO.
      Returns:
      boolean mlrMsgValidation() equals MLR_VALIDATION_NO

      MLR_VALIDATION_NO = 0x01

    • mlrValidationYes

      public boolean mlrValidationYes()
      Return true if mlrMsgValidation() equals MLR_VALIDATION_YES.
      Returns:
      boolean mlrMsgValidation() equals MLR_VALIDATION_YES

      MLR_VALIDATION_YES = 0x02

    • mlrCsdapiChange

      public boolean mlrCsdapiChange()
      Returns:
      boolean mlrXmltrnfmChangeAgent() equals MLR_CSDAPI_CHANGE

      MLR_CSDAPI_CHANGE = 0x01

    • mlrCsdbatchChange

      public boolean mlrCsdbatchChange()
      Returns:
      boolean mlrXmltrnfmChangeAgent() equals MLR_CSDBATCH_CHANGE

      MLR_CSDBATCH_CHANGE = 0x02

    • mlrDrepapiChange

      public boolean mlrDrepapiChange()
      Returns:
      boolean mlrXmltrnfmChangeAgent() equals MLR_DREPAPI_CHANGE

      MLR_DREPAPI_CHANGE = 0x03

    • mlrCreateChange

      public boolean mlrCreateChange()
      Returns:
      boolean mlrXmltrnfmChangeAgent() equals MLR_CREATE_CHANGE

      MLR_CREATE_CHANGE = 0x04

    • mlrDynamicChange

      public boolean mlrDynamicChange()
      Returns:
      boolean mlrXmltrnfmChangeAgent() equals MLR_DYNAMIC_CHANGE

      MLR_DYNAMIC_CHANGE = 0x08

    • mlrDynamicInstall

      public boolean mlrDynamicInstall()
      Returns:
      boolean mlrXmltrnfmInstallAgent() equals MLR_DYNAMIC_INSTALL

      MLR_DYNAMIC_INSTALL = 0x08

    • mlrBundleInstall

      public boolean mlrBundleInstall()
      Returns:
      boolean mlrXmltrnfmInstallAgent() equals MLR_BUNDLE_INSTALL

      MLR_BUNDLE_INSTALL = 0x09

    • create

      public static XmlTransformStatistics create(byte[] Data, int offset, int length)
      create is intended for internal use only. Instances of this section are created by the parent record or section.
      Parameters:
      Data - Array of bytes containing data for this section
      offset - Offset of this section in the data
      length - length of the section